Static ARP TableThe Address Resolution Protocol (ARP) is a TCP/IP protocol that converts IP addresses into physical addresses.This table allows networ
To maximize stability, the hop count RIP uses to measure distance must have a low maximum value. Infinity (that is, the network is unreachable) is def

OSPF AuthenticationOSPF packets can be authenticated as coming from trusted routers by the use of predefined passwords.The default for routers is to u
AdjacenciesAdjacent routers go beyond the simple Hello exchange and participate in the link-state database exchange process. OSPF elects one router as

Link-State Acknowledgment PacketLink-State Acknowledgment packets are OSPF packet type 5.To make the folding of link-state advertisements reliable, fl
Link State Advertisement HeaderAll link state advertisements begin with a common 20-byte header.This header contains enough information to uniquely id

Mapping Domain Names to AddressesName-to-address translation is performed by a program called a Name server.The client program is called a Name resolv

DVMRP Interface ConfigurationThe Distance Vector Multicast Routing Protocol (DVMRP) is a hop-based method of building multicast delivery trees from mu

6-6 Port MirroringThe Switch allows you to copy frames transmitted and received on a port and redirect the copies to another port.You can attach a mon
The Switch treats all ports in a trunk group as a single port. Data transmitted to a specific host (destination address) will always be transmitted ov

IGMP SnoopingInternet Group Management Protocol (IGMP) snooping allows the Switch to recognize IGMP queries and reports sent between network stations

802.1w Rapid Spanning TreeThe Switch implements three versions of the Spanning Tree Protocol, the Multiple Spanning Tree Protocol (MSTP) as defined by

6-14 VLANsUnderstanding IEEE 802.1p PriorityPriority tagging is a function defined by the IEEE 802.1p standard designed to provide a means of managing
The main characteristics of IEEE 802.1Q are as follows:• Assigns packets to VLANs by filtering.• Assumes the presence of a single global spanning tree
Figure 6- 38. IEEE 802.1Q TagThe EtherType and VLAN ID are inserted after the MAC source address, but before the original EtherType/Length or Logical
Port VLAN IDPackets that are tagged (are carrying the 802.1Q VID information) can be transmitted from one 802.1Q compliant network device to another w

6-18 QoSThe AT-9724TS supports 802.1p priority queuing Quality of Service.The following section discusses the implementation of QoS (Quality of Servic
A~H with their respective weight value: 8~1, the packets are sent in the following sequence:A1, B1, C1, D1, E1, F1, G1, H1,A2, B2, C2, D2, E2, F2, G2,
